    Now that the horses have escaped the NCAA has decided to close the barn door.

     

    an_ref

    The NCAA is issuing new guidance "to establish a standard timing protocol that ensures consistency in the administration of all college football games," in the wake of Michigan's controversial 13-12 victory over Western Michigan on Saturday.

    ESPN obtained a copy of a memo from NCAA national coordinator of officials Ron Snodgrass, which was approved by the NCAA's secretary rules editor, Matt Young.

    "The official time for all college football games is the time displayed on the in-stadium game clock," the memo said. "When a replay review requires time to be restored or otherwise adjusted, the replay official's decision will be based on the embedded game clock contained within the program feed. If the broadcaster is unable to provide an embedded game clock, the replay official will use the game-clock graphic displayed as part of the broadcast feed.

    "This timing protocol should be followed consistently at all institutions and game sites."

    an_blowhorn Had that guidance been in place and followed Saturday, Michigan would not have been given an extra play and Western Michigan would have won the game 12-7, based on the clock shown on the NBC broadcast.

    Quote Originally Posted by Brewmeister:

     

    Fubah please tell me why Army is a 3.5 favorite against USF? The latter is clearly the more talented team not to mention the fact that an Army coach went to USF in the off season so they will be in Army's huddle all game. I am a huge Black Knights fan but don't get the number at all.... BOL

     

    @Brewmeister

     cool Ok bud, I think I can help you with that.......USF had a better team (9 - 4) last year than did ARMY (7 - 6) BUT this year their entire team has been gutted....According to CBS Sports article featuring "returning production" for every CFB team, USF only has 3 returning:  a WR, an OL and a DB. That's it! .... ARMY has 11 returning - and most importantly - as a run first offense, they have 5 of their starting 6 OL blockers back, their RB, AND their mobile QB! Both team's defense will be new except at least ARMY returns 2 starters on the critical DL...USF returns O on the DL and only one on the OL....... LINES are paramount to success.  Must have.  And the QB of course, which ARMY returns, but not USF.

    This scenario played out in ARMY's first game vs Bryant (weak FCS team) ARMY routed them of course  but by a whopping 59 - 3 (no cheapie/lucky TDs either!) and posted 569 rushing yards alone!  Even facing an FBS team we wouldn't expect such a 56 pt margin if ARMY was a low rated team.  Those margins are what are usually achieved by teams rated among the top 50 in FCS.  Their offense returns almost fully intact (with QB!) and it shows.  They will be a force to reckon with in AAC play for sure.

    As for USF, bench players and transfers make up their team - and it showed in their first game......Yes, they won 19 - 9 but they were on homefield and facing weakass FIU (only returning 5, and significantly WEAKER THAN ARMY) .....and that weakass FIU Panthers team, playing on the road at USF, despite yielding more penalties and  -3 net turnovers to USF, in a game that was 6 - 3 entering the 4th Q, the weakass FIU squad *DOMINATED* the stat sheet in spite of thoise turnovers and pens, to the tune of 381 net yards to just 208 for USF....whose lone TD was a gift from an int at the 35........And ARMY - on homefield - is much, MUCH better than weakass FIU....

     

    LEANING ARMY (likely buying a couple points)
